What does the CID do in military?
As the U.S. Army’s primary criminal investigative organization and the Department of Defense’s premier investigative organization, the U.S. Army Criminal Investigation Division, commonly known as CID, is responsible for conducting felony-level criminal investigations in which the Army is, or may be, a party of interest
What rank is CID?
The head of the CID in most police forces is a Detective Chief Superintendent. Ranks are abbreviated as follows: Detective Constable (DC or Det Con) Detective Sergeant (DS or Det Sgt)
Who investigates crimes in the UK?
There are 43 police forces across England and Wales responsible for the investigation of crime, collection of evidence and the arrest or detention of suspected offenders.

What does CID do in the police?
CID detectives primarily investigate felony-level crime and provide investigative support to the patrol division. They conduct a wide variety of investigations to include deaths, sexual assault, armed robbery, computer crimes and counter-drug operations.

What does the NCA do in the UK?
The National Crime Agency leads the UK’s fight to cut serious and organised crime, protecting the public by disrupting and bringing to justice those serious and organised criminals who pose the highest risk to the UK.

What is LAPD CID?
Commission Investigation Division (CID) is the regulatory arm of the Police Commission with respect to the processing, issuance, investigation, enforcement and discipline of Police Commission permits.
What crimes do CID investigate UK?
criminal investigations department (CID) – handles incidents such as suspicious deaths, serious assaults, robbery, burglary and major property thefts, domestic abuse or racist abuse. fraud squad – investigates company and financial fraud.
